Chapter 1 - chapter 1 : The Orchard That Never Spoke

Rohan had lived in the village his whole life, but there was one place he never understood—

the orchard that stood at the edge of the fields.

People called it The Silent Orchard.

Not because it was quiet…

but because nothing inside it ever made a sound.

No birds.

No rustling leaves.

No wind.

Just silence.

Complete, unnatural silence.

Every evening, when Rohan returned from school, he felt the same strange pull—

as if the orchard watched him walk past.

Some days it felt harmless.

Some days it felt hungry.

Today… it felt different.

Like it was waiting.

The First Sign

As Rohan walked by the rusted fence, a cold wave brushed past his ear—

a sudden drop in temperature that didn't match the warm February air.

He stopped instantly.

A faint mist curled around his feet,

as if the ground beneath the orchard was breathing.

Rohan swallowed.

"Why does this place always feel alive…?"

He took one step forward—

just enough to peek through the branches.

That's when he saw her.

Not clearly.

Not fully.

Just a red shape,

the silhouette of a girl,

standing deep between the trees.

Still.

Unmoving.

Facing him.

Rohan blinked—

and she vanished.

His breath caught in his chest.

"Again… this red figure.

Who is she?"

But his question remained unanswered,

swallowed by the orchard's suffocating silence.

A Whisper Without Sound

Rohan took a step back from the fence.

And the moment he turned away—

A shiver ran down his spine.

Not a sound.

Not a voice.

But a… feeling.

A message.

A whisper without noise:

"…come back tonight."

Rohan froze in place.

He didn't hear it with his ears.

He felt it inside his mind.

He looked over his shoulder—

the orchard stood still.

Silent.

Empty.

Yet the message lingered like cold fingers on the back of his neck.

Rohan swallowed hard.

"Why… why me?"

The orchard didn't answer.

It never needed to.

It simply waited.

And as the evening light faded,

Rohan knew one thing for sure:

This night was not going to be normal.

The Silent Orchard had chosen him.
